You'll adore your new place in Vallejo, CA. Located at 148 Florida St in Vallejo, this apartment unit for rent provides easy access to city amenities and attractions. With this great space, you'll feel right at home. Let us assist you! Contact us now to discuss the next steps!
Florida St 4 Plex is located in Vallejo, California in the 94590 zip code.